MIROS Trials Minimum Highway Speed, Slow Driving Risks

Malaysia has begun a trial that puts a floor on highway speeds, aiming to curb lane hogging and smooth traffic flow. The proof‑of‑concept, launched on August 1, uses advisory signs that tell drivers the minimum speed expected for each lane on selected expressways.

How the advisory system works
Under the banner Had Laju Nasihat Minimum, the Malaysian Institute of Road Safety Research (MIROS) together with the Malaysian Highway Authority (LLM), PLUS and the SKVE, installed signboards on three pilot stretches. Each lane displays a recommended minimum speed, and motorists are asked to travel at least that pace unless weather or congestion makes it unsafe.
Drivers who wish to move more slowly are expected to stay in the leftmost lane; the lanes to the right carry higher advisory minima. The signage is not enforceable like a speed limit; it merely offers guidance, and the trial’s five objectives include preventing lane monopolising, narrowing speed gaps, boosting capacity, and lowering the chance of hazardous lane changes.

Locations and expectations
The trial covers the northbound segment of PLUS E1 from Tanjung Malim to Behrang, the SKVE E26 corridor between Ayer Hitam toll plaza and Bandar Saujana Putra, and the northbound stretch of PLUS E2 from Bandar Ainsdale to Nilai. Along these routes, motorists are reminded to match their lane to the posted advisory minimum, give way to overtaking vehicles, and keep a safe following distance.
“Jangan jadi punca trafik terganggu,” the agency’s announcement read, urging drivers not to become the source of traffic disruption.
Research shows that the biggest safety risk on high‑speed roads comes from speed variance rather than absolute speed. A vehicle traveling well below the average flow creates a moving obstacle that forces following drivers to brake, change lanes, and accelerate, each step presenting an opportunity for error. Historical studies, such as the 1964 “Solomon curve,” demonstrated a U‑shaped relationship between crash rates and deviation from mean traffic speed, with higher risk for both faster and slower drivers. Subsequent analyses confirmed that large speed differences, even on modern highways, increase the likelihood of collisions.
From a broader perspective, the trial reflects a move toward managing traffic as a system rather than relying solely on static limits. By encouraging drivers to self‑sort according to lane‑specific speeds, the approach seeks to reduce the ripple effects of braking waves that can stretch for kilometres, a phenomenon observed in experiments where a single slow car triggered stop‑and‑go traffic jams. If successful, the advisory system could be expanded to more routes, offering a low‑cost tool to improve flow without adding new enforcement mechanisms.

Critics may argue that enforcing a minimum speed could be difficult, especially in heavy rain or during peak congestion. However, the trial explicitly exempts such conditions, and the advisory nature of the signs means compliance relies on driver awareness rather than legal compulsion. The real test will be whether motorists adjust their lane choices voluntarily and whether the measured outcomes—fewer abrupt lane changes and smoother traffic density—justify broader rollout.
Early observations suggest that drivers who keep to the left when traveling slowly reduce the need for sudden overtaking manoeuvres. Conversely, vehicles that linger in the fast lane at low speeds force others to weave around them, creating blind‑spot hazards and increasing the chance of rear‑end crashes. One widely shared local incident illustrated this risk when a slow‑moving car in the overtaking lane was struck from behind, prompting calls for clearer lane discipline.
Should the data from the three test sections show a decline in speed differentials and related incidents, policymakers may consider integrating advisory minimums into the national highway signage program. Until then, the guidance remains a voluntary prompt: match your speed to the lane you occupy, let faster traffic pass, and avoid becoming the catalyst for unnecessary lane changes.
